The WA Minister for State Development (the proponent) has approval to develop land for irrigated agriculture across the Weaber, Keep River and Knox Creek Plains, located north-northeast of Kununurra in the eastern Kimberley region of WA and extends to the Keep River estuary in the Northern Territory. The area of development (M2 Area) is immediately northeast of the existing Ord River Irrigation Area (ORIA), with proposed development representing the second stage of the ORIA scheme. It comprises approximately 76 000 ha (including Buffer Areas) and a key part of the development is main irrigation channel (the ‘M2 channel’), that extends from Lake Kununurra alongside the M1 channel.
